Ingredients
– 4 cups all-purpose flour
– 1 packet (2 ¼ teaspoons) active dry yeast
– 1 ½ cups warm water (about 110°F or 43°C)
– 2 tablespoons granulated sugar
– 2 teaspoons salt
– ¼ cup baking soda
– 1 large egg (for egg wash)
– Coarse sea salt (for topping)
Instructions
Creating Homemade Soft Pretzels is straightforward when you follow these steps:
1. Activate Yeast: In a large bowl, combine warm water, yeast, and sugar. Let it sit for about 5 minutes until frothy.
2. Combine Dry Ingredients: In another bowl, mix the flour and salt together.
3. Form Dough: Gradually add the flour mixture to the yeast mixture, stirring until a dough forms.
4. Knead Dough: Transfer the dough to a floured surface and knead for about 5-7 minutes until smooth and elastic.
5. First Rise: Place the dough in a greased bowl, cover with a clean towel, and let it rise in a warm place for about 1 hour or until doubled in size.
6. Preheat Oven: Preheat your oven to 450°F (232°C) and line two baking sheets with parchment paper.
7. Shape Pretzels: Punch down the risen dough and divide it into 8 equal pieces. Roll each piece into a long rope (about 24 inches) and shape into a pretzel.
8. Prepare Baking Soda Bath: In a large pot, bring 10 cups of water to a boil. Add the baking soda carefully.
9. Boil Pretzels: Drop each pretzel into the boiling water for about 30 seconds, then remove with a slotted spoon and place on the prepared baking sheets.
10. Egg Wash: Beat the egg and brush it over each pretzel. Sprinkle coarse sea salt on top.
11. Bake: Bake for 12-15 minutes or until golden brown.
12. Cool: Let the pretzels cool on a wire rack for a few minutes before serving.
